"THE PLAN"
when i pull my 60 drivetrain for my v8 conversion, i will mate my built 2f in the 40 to the 4spd and t-case out of the 60.
put the 4.11's back in the 60,and the 4.88's will go in the 40.
cut as much sheet metal off the 40 as possable.
1/4s will be trimmed extensivly.
inner tub will lose alot of metal and the tub will be tubed for a back seat for the kid.
front fenders will be modified and tubed.
rockers cut,sliders(go figure)
prolly stick with the suspension set up i have right now.
and go 36 or 37's
cage will be reworked and tied into the frame.

REZARF said:
You gonna leave us hanging like that or what? I have heard sand in the tube helps... help a brother out will ya!

BTW, where are you in S. Denver? I head through there often because my girl lives in the Springs. I am in Louisville. Give a hollar if you ever need a hand.

Thanks-

Rezarf <><

what i did was cut a piece of tube in half about 6 inches long, and i lay the half pieces between the rollers(that do not roll) and the tube i'm bending.(spreads the load)
and if i'm workin at the end of a tube, i have a piece of solid steel to put in the end to keep it from colapsing.

son of a gun!
i bought some hrew 2" .120 yesterday,tried to bend it in my bender last night.
:frown: no go, i think its to thick walled for it.it would bend it, but it would kink up the inside radius and slightly flatten out the outside.

started with a 10' section for a side piece.then i had to cut it in half and fart around with a 5' piece to see if i could get it to work......no dice, :frown:
